[PATCH] ieee80211: fix not allocating IV+ICV space when usingencryption in ieee80211_tx_frame

We should preallocate IV+ICV space when encrypting the frame.
Currently no problem shows up just because dev_alloc_skb aligns the
data len to SMP_CACHE_BYTES which can be used for ICV.
